How Much Time Does Plaster Need to Completely Cure?
While handling plaster, it's important to understand that the drying time and curing process are different. Usually, plaster dries to the touch within 24-48 hours, according to temperature and humidity. However, total curing needs an extended period-usually 4-6 weeks. During the curing phase, moisture steadily evaporates, enabling the plaster to achieve its maximum hardness and durability. Don't paint or finish the surface until the curing process has finished to avoid compromising the finish.
How Does Extreme Weather Affect Plastering Work?
Did you know that plaster's hardening process can decrease by up to 50% when temperatures fall below 5°C? When plastering in extreme weather conditions, you face major problems like rapid drying, cracking, or slow curing. To mitigate these issues, you need to use protective shelters, heaters, or insulation materials. Effective insulation improves the curing process, maintaining ideal temperatures and humidity, making certain your plaster reaches the required durability, strength, and surface finish.

What Is the Environmental Impact of Modern Plaster Materials?
Have you thought about how your selection of plaster materials influences the environment? Modern plaster typically uses gypsum, which demands considerable resources for harvesting and production, increasing carbon emissions. Yet, you can opt for environmentally conscious choices like lime-based plasters, which capture CO₂ during curing. Producers now embrace sustainable practices, including recycled materials and energy-efficient kilns. When choosing these options, you'll assist in decreasing the environmental impact while still achieving high-performance finishes.
Maintaining Plastered Surfaces: What You Need to Know
To keep plastered surfaces in good condition, you should carry out routine surface cleaning using a gentle brush or damp cloth to clean away dust and debris, staying clear of abrasive materials that might harm the finish. Be sure to verify paint compatibility before adding any new coatings, confirming the plaster is properly dried and free of moisture. Regularly check for damage or separation, and fix minor issues promptly to avoid moisture ingress and protect structural integrity.
